1995 Fiat Tempra vs. 1981 Nissan Sunny
To start off, 1995 Fiat Tempra is newer by 14 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1981 Nissan Sunny.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1981 Nissan Sunny would be higher. At 1,487 cc (4 cylinders), 1981 Nissan Sunny is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Fiat Tempra (75 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 1 more horse power than 1981 Nissan Sunny. (74 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Fiat Tempra should accelerate faster than 1981 Nissan Sunny.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1981 Nissan Sunny (123 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 13 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Fiat Tempra. (110 Nm @ 2900 RPM). This means 1981 Nissan Sunny will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Fiat Tempra.
Compare all specifications:
1995 Fiat Tempra | 1981 Nissan Sunny | |
Make | Fiat | Nissan |
Model | Tempra | Sunny |
Year Released | 1995 | 1981 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1372 cc | 1487 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 75 HP | 74 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 110 Nm | 123 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2900 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4360 mm | 4140 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1700 mm | 1630 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1360 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2550 mm | 2410 mm |
